Alan Forsyth again on the mark for Scotland in the EuroHockey Championship II in Glasgow.

Alan Forsyth claimed two goals in three, second-half minutes as Scotland came from behind to snatch a 2-1 win over Ukraine in the EuroHockey Championship II in Glasgow.

Oleh Polishchuk netted for Ukraine after 34 minutes and it took Derek Forsyth’s team until the 55th minute to level following a penalty stroke award.

And former Kelburne star Forsyth, who now plays for English side Surbiton, was on the mark again three minutes after that from a penalty corner to secure the home side’s third win in Pool A.
